The bilingual and bi-national workforce centered around the cities of El Paso in Texas, Las Cruces in New Mexico, and Ciudad Juarez in the Mexican state of Chihuahua are the backbone for both a vibrant culture and an energized economy.  With so many opportunities, El Paso growth is imminent. Here are just a few of the particulars:

Population – While the city of El Paso has a population just under 700,000,  the entire three city area holds almost 3 million residents. Not only is it the 20th largest metro area in the U.S. but also the safest. In fact, the tri-city area, multi-racial area has ranked at the top four times in the last five years. In addition, the upcoming expansions of the Army's Fort Bliss and the University of Texas Medical Center means that even more residents with advanced credentials and valuable experience will join the burgeoning work force.

Economy – Without a doubt, the cross-border trade that takes place in El Paso and its sister cities has had a tremendously beneficial effect on the economy of the area. Over $100B worth of trade crossed the border near El Paso in 2015 and the partnership continues to expand. In addition, the city and its environs are a regional hotspot for oil & gas exploration and production companies. In fact, Western refining, a Fortune 500 Company, is headquartered in the city.

Culture – El Paso is home to many cultural activities. Some, like the International Art Museum and the Museum of History, are intended to be relaxing ventures, while others, like Balloonfest and the Texas Showdown Festival, are sure to be exhilarating. El Paso also features a world-class zoo and botanical gardens, as well as both a symphony orchestra and a ballet company. El Paso also hosts a half-dozen musical festivals that lure millions of visitors every year.
